LIVINGSTON, Ala. – The University of West Alabama men's tennis team continues its early-season slate with a home matchup against Spring Hill on Tuesday. First serve is set for 2:00 p.m.
West Alabama (0-1) is looking to bounce back from its season opener against Alabama State, while Spring Hill will be making its 2025 season debut.
